What Are Diet Medications?
Diet medications, likewise referred to as anti-obesity medications, are prescription drugs targeted at helping people in dropping weight by reducing appetite, increasing sensations of fullness, or obstructing fat absorption. They are normally recommended for individuals with a body mass index (BMI) greater than 30 or those with a BMI over 27 who likewise have weight-related health conditions.
Types of Diet Medications
Diet medications can mainly be classified into 3 types based upon their systems of action:
TypeMechanismExamplesFDA ApprovalAppetite SuppressantsReduction appetite signals in the brainPhentermine, DiethylpropionYesAbsorption InhibitorsReduce the body's ability to take in dietary fatOrlistat (Alli, Xenical)YesHormone ModulatorsAlter hormones associated with appetite policy and metabolismLiraglutide (Saxenda), Semaglutide (Wegovy)YesAppetite SuppressantsSummary

Absorption inhibitors avoid the body from absorbing a portion of the fat from the food taken in, successfully minimizing caloric consumption. They might be helpful for individuals who struggle to manage their fat usage through dietary changes alone.
Common Absorption InhibitorsOrlistat: This medication blocks the enzyme lipase, which is necessary for fat absorption.MedicationDoseCommon Side EffectsOrlistat120 mg with mealsOily stools, flatulence, stomach crampsHormonal ModulatorsOverview
Hormonal modulators simulate the results of naturally occurring hormonal agents that control appetite and glucose metabolism. This class of medications can also improve metabolic health, making them reliable for weight management.
Typical Hormonal ModulatorsLiraglutide (Saxenda): Mimics the GLP-1 hormone, which promotes satiety and reduces appetite.Semaglutide (Wegovy): Similar to liraglutide but typically more effective due to its formulation.MedicationDoseCommon Side EffectsLiraglutide3 mg when dailyQueasiness, vomiting, diarrheaSemaglutide2.4 mg once weeklyGastrointestinal concerns, headachesProspective Side Effects
While diet medications can be helpful, they likewise include prospective side impacts. Each medication has a distinct profile:

Common Side Effects:
NauseaIrregularitySleeping disordersIncreased heart rateAnxiety
Serious Risks:
Cardiovascular issuesIntestinal issuesPsychological health concerns
It is important for people to discuss these risks with their doctor to identify the very best course of action.
